Then They Went After Infrastructure
Cyberwarfare changes everything.
A foreign adversary no longer needs to send soldiers across a border to hurt a country.
It can attack the systems holding that country together.
Water.
Electricity.
Communications.
Transportation.
Financial networks.
Industrial control systems.
Programmable controllers.
The battlefield can be a computer terminal sitting thousands of miles away.
That is why the reported attack against American municipal water systems matters so much.
If Iran was indeed behind the Minnesota attacks, the escalation is profound.
This is no longer simply hostile rhetoric aimed at Trump.
It is potentially hostile activity aimed at American civilians and infrastructure.
And America cannot protect every water system the way it protects a president.
There cannot be F-16s hovering over every pumping station.
There cannot be Secret Service agents guarding every municipal control system.
That is exactly what makes cyberwarfare so attractive to hostile governments.
It attacks the seams.
